Summary

Senate Bill 2945 aims to make an appropriation of $300,000 from the State General Fund to the City of Philadelphia, Mississippi, for the purchase of a fire truck in the fiscal year 2025. This financial support is intended to enhance the local fire department's operational capabilities and ensure the provision of adequate emergency services to the community.
